India, April 24 -- Amid sweeping retaliatory tariffs imposed by the US on Vietnam, South Korean tech major Samsung is reportedly considering shifting some of its smartphone and electronics manufacturing to India.
As per Moneycontrol, the company has begun talks with Indian electronics manufacturing players to explore the possibility of shifting a portion of its manufacturing from Vietnam.
"Yes, talks have begun with Indian EMS players, including their existing partners. Not just Samsung, all other companies with a base in Vietnam are exploring possibilities to shift some production to India," a source reportedly said.
